System malfunction

OJF058394L
• When the FCA is not working
properly, the FCA warning light
(
) will illuminate and the
warning message will appear for
a few seconds. After the message
disappears, the master warning
light (
) will illuminate. In this
case, have the vehicle inspected

WARNING
• The FCA is only a supplemental
system for the driver's
convenience. The driver should
hold the responsibility to control
the vehicle operation. Do not
solely depend on the FCA system.
Rather, maintain a safe braking
distance, and, if necessary,
depress the brake pedal to lower
the driving speed.
• In certain instances and under
certain driving conditions, the
FCA system may activate
unintentionally. This initial warning
message appears on the LCD
display with a warning chime.
Also, in certain instances the
front radar sensor or camera
recognition system may not
detect the vehicle, pedestrian or
cyclist (if equipped) ahead. The
FCA system may not activate and
the warning message will not be
displayed.
